  20. Just to clarify, when you enable the VPN on your PC, does that prevent internet access or just access to the router interface? If the latter then that is expected, you're creating a network tunnel that then excludes the router. The easiest way to circumvent CG-NAT is to contact your ISP, they may be able to remove you from it (I've only seen that happen for one person) or get a static IP from them (they may charge extra for this), otherwise switching to an ISP that doesn't use CG-NAT.
